Abstract
Tunable spacing of O-band multi wavelength Brillouin fiber laser is demonstrated. The channel spacing is varied by employing two types of cavities. A full closed linear cavity produce multi wavelength Brillouin fiber laser with 12.5GHz while a ring cavity provide channel spacing of 25.0 GHz. By combining these two cavities and employing optical channel switch, the channel spacing are varied. The comparison of Brillouin threshold between O-band and C-band is demonstrated. In particular, an O-band transmission window is used instead of C-band due to its lower Brillouin threshold.
